Permianville Royalty Trust is a statutory trust which holds net profits interests in the profits from the sale of oil and natural gas production from non-operated assets of both conventional properties in the States of Texas, Louisiana, and New Mexico as well as unconventional assets in the Permian and Haynesville basins.
XIAO-I Corp operates as a cognitive artificial intelligence company. Using its proprietary intellectual property technologies, the company has developed and commercialized various core technologies, such as Conversational AI, Knowledge Fusion, Intelligence Voice, Hyperautomation, Data Intelligence, Cloud, Intelligent Construction Support, Vision Analysis, Intelligent Hardware Support, and Metaverse. Additionally, it has developed Hua Zang Universal Large Language Model. XIAO-I offers two different product lines: Model as a service (MaaS) and non-MaaS. Key revenue is derived from the non-MaaS product line, which comprises needs assessment, solution design and architecture planning, development and configuration, deployment, and implementation of non-model (mainly cloud platform) products.
